What is the slope-intercept form of the linear equation 2x - 8y = 32

Mathematics
2 answers:
SSSSS [86.1K]3 years ago
8 0
You will need to simplify the equation by:
2x - 8y = 32
put the x on the other side but negative.
-8y = -2x +32
ok so it will need to divide the negative 8 on y.
y = -2/-8x + 32/-8
simplify:
y = 1/4 + -4

So the slope is 1/4
The y intercept is -4

A partial proof was constructed given that MNOP is a parallelogram.
Yanka [14]
A diagram of parallelogram MNOP is attached below

We have side MN || side OP and side MP || NO

Using the rule of angles in parallel lines, ∠M and ∠P are supplementary as well as ∠M and ∠N.

Since ∠M+∠P = 180° and ∠M+∠N=180°, we can conclude that ∠P and ∠N are of equal size. 

∠N and ∠O are supplementary by the rules of angles in parallel lines
∠O and ∠P are supplementary by the rules of angles in parallel lines

∠N+∠O=180° and ∠O+∠P=180°

∠N and ∠P are of equal size

we deduce further that ∠M and ∠O are of equal size

Hence, the correct statement to complete the proof is

<span>∠M ≅ ∠O; ∠N ≅ ∠P
